2015 Charger Reskin Rocklin Police 1.0.0

(1 review)

4 Screenshots

I saw that no one made a Rocklin police vehicle so, being my hometown, I decided to create it. This is my first vehicle I've reskinned, and I hope you enjoy. To install, First download 2015 Dodge Charger RT Police and then open up the ytd file, and replace the policenew_sign_1.

@kalidacope For a first timer this is a decent start. I like that you took the initiative and tried to make your own rather than just requesting skins like everyone else! You took the time to take in-game pictures as well and that's a big plus!

I think constructive criticism is worth its weight in gold though, so here's what I think may help to point out. Two things I saw off the bat, aside from the credits we have no idea whose 2015 Charger you used and there are several on this site, many of which use different templates which mean your skin would likely not work. Second, your lines for the white on both doors need some work, one door has a very obvious spill over on the rear-quarter. Fixing those would make it acceptably good.

If you want to match one of the actual vehicles, I noticed they do not actually have a Charger from what I can find, but the CVPI and Explorer are close enough to make judgments on... The white from the doors should come straight down the front part onto the sideskirts, but you staggered yours back a bit. The font that you chose while it works, is definitely not the correct font and I've gone through the struggles of finding that font before myself as well, it is out there!

If you want help with correcting some of these or even to be pointed in the right direction feel free to reach out to me or ask for help in the Modding Help Forums.
